About the Role
We're seeking a dedicated and professional Respiratory Scientist to join our supportive team.
In this role, you will:
* Perform a range of lung function tests, including spirometry, DLCO, body plethysmography, 6-minute walk test and more
* Ensure all testing meets accreditation standards
* Provide a calm, clear and supportive experience for patients
* Participate in quality assurance programs
* Work collaboratively with physicians, admin staff, and clinical colleagues
* Assist with lab-related administrative duties
* Have the option to be involved in clinical research projects
